This is the first of a three-part series on prom written by local youth pastors. The series begins running today, Tuesday, April 15, and will appear Tuesday, April 22, and Tuesday, April 29. Watch for it and share it with your teens.
It’s prom time again. The girls put on the lovely dress they bought months ago. It’s the dress they’ve been dreaming about for years. The guys put on their tuxes, get a haircut and I’ve heard that some of them even shower for this special occasion. It’s also the time when parents and youth ministers all over the country begin their all-night prayer vigil. “Please God protect my child and help them to make good decisions.”
